Output e159d53655b4a8718048b25f8d083d5225ed8f8a535741a5b3cf5b696937396c:83

value
3346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95f7e16f74267d4d86f2ac6199ecb0b5c8bf81dc059516f0e0fb1839d4d5c91d
address
bc1pjhm7zmm5ye75mphj43senm9skhytlqwuqk23du8qlvvrn4x4eywss3587l
transaction
e159d53655b4a8718048b25f8d083d5225ed8f8a535741a5b3cf5b696937396c
spent
true